Hiram Scott College
Hiram Scott College was a private liberal arts college that operated from 1965 to 1972 in Scottsbluff, Nebraska. Hiram Scott was one of several Midwestern colleges established by local civic leaders with the support and encouragement of Parsons College in Fairfield, Iowa. These Parsons "satellite schools" were by-products of the strong growth and apparent success of Parsons during the late 1950s and early 1960s, and all followed the "Parsons Plan" academic model developed at that school.

D. A. Murphy Panhandle Arboretum
The D. A. Murphy Panhandle Arboretum (40 acres) is an arboretum located at the University of Nebraska Panhandle Research and Extension Center, 4502 Avenue I, Scottsbluff, Nebraska. The Arboretum was established in 1984 as the University of Nebraska Panhandle Arboretum, and in 1985 recognized as a Nebraska Statewide Arboretum affiliate. In 1987 the Arboretum was awarded a generous endowment from local businessman D. A. Murphy's estate and renamed in his honor.

KOLT (AM)
KOLT is a radio station broadcasting a News Talk Information format. Licensed to Scottsbluff, Nebraska, USA. The station is currently owned by Tracy Broadcasting Corporation and features programing from AP Radio and ESPN Radio.

Scotts Bluff County, Nebraska
Scotts Bluff County is a county located on the western border of the U.S. state of Nebraska. As of 2010, the population was 36,970, making Scotts Bluff the 6th-largest county (by population) in Nebraska. Its county seat is Gering and its largest city is Scottsbluff.
